Need a Place for Unwanted Summer Clothes?

 

With seasons about to change, do you have summer clothes you no longer need or don’t want to store for the winter? If so, we will be collecting summer clothes for a good cause until September 27– just drop them off at church. They will be sent to Dominica, a small country in the Caribbean that was recently hit hard by a hurricane. For those members who remember Girbe Grosse, an active member in the 1990’s before he died, his last live in aide Dora is from Dominica and has reached out asking for our help. Any summer clothes or old sheets are desperately needed as many of the residents were left with nothing following the storm. Paulette and Ron Appleton will be dropping off whatever is collected at the end of the month to Dora who will be shipping them on. Your help is greatly appreciated. Thank You Ron and Paulette

NJ SYNOD HAND IN HAND DAYS: Volunteers are the hands, heart, and soul of the ongoing Superstorm Sandy recovery efforts still happening throughout the state of New Jersey. You are invited to come and team up with others from across the state to volunteer your time and effors to help those who hurt, who are in need, and who have limited choices due to Superstorm Sandy. The last Hand in Hand date is: October 24th from 9-3. Won’t you check your calendars now and see if you and your family are available to help one?
